Overview

History & significance

Ffridd Fedw Round Hut, Enclosure, Ancient Fields and Kerb Cairn is a prehistoric kerb cairn located in Wales. The monument sits upon bedrock of Middle Cambrian age, composed of mudstone, siltstone and sandstone, which would have been available locally for construction. The kerb cairn represents a burial or ceremonial monument type common across prehistoric Britain and Ireland, built by stacking stone around a central chamber or deposit. The associated landscape features including the round hut, enclosure and ancient fields reveal a wider pattern of prehistoric land use and settlement at this location.

The cairn's survival to the present day, despite centuries of agricultural activity on the surrounding lands, suggests either deliberate preservation or location in marginal terrain unsuitable for intensive farming. The Middle Cambrian geology of the site, whilst not ideal for tool-making, would have provided adequate material for the cairn's construction. The complex of monuments at Ffridd Fedw demonstrates how prehistoric communities organised their use of the landscape, combining domestic occupation with ritual and burial practices.

The monument is protected by Cadw, the Welsh Historic Monuments service, under reference ME111, ensuring its preservation for future archaeological study and public understanding of Wales's prehistoric heritage.
